OpenCiv3, an initiative to reimagine the classic strategy game Civilization III as an open-source and cross-platform project, has been announced. The project aims to provide a modern, accessible version of the popular title, allowing it to run on various operating systems beyond its original scope. By embracing an open-source model, OpenCiv3 invites community contributions and collaborative development, potentially leading to new features, improvements, and long-term sustainability for the game. This development is significant for fans of Civilization III and the broader open-source gaming community, as it seeks to preserve and enhance a beloved title for future generations of players. The official announcement was made on February 6, 2026, and further updates are expected to be shared via its official website, openciv3.org.
